Boakye Family Adinkra Workshop

Ntonso, Kwabre East District (near Kumasi)

In Ntonso, the source village for Adinkra symbol-stamping, the Boakye family has hand-carved calabash stamps and pressed bark-dyed cloth across four generations, led into her nineties by matriarch Veronica Abena Tebi. The workshop still teaches the stamping technique on-site to visitors and to younger family members carrying the craft forward.
